South Carolina Code § 37-30-175

Civil actions.

A consumer who suffers loss by reason of a violation of this chapter may bring a civil action to enforce the provisions, and if successful in the action, shall recover actual damages, reasonable attorney's fees, and court costs incurred by bringing the action.
Editor's Note
2015 Act No. 31, SECTION 3, provides as follows:
"SECTION 3. This act takes effect upon approval by the Governor and applies to all GAP waivers which become effective one hundred eighty days after the effective date."
